Runbook 4.2 — Restoring operator access to Splitgate, the A/B experiment assignment service.

If an operator account is locked out, do not reassign experiments manually; assignment hashes must stay deterministic. First verify the requester's identity per the Tallow Ridge support protocol, then open a recovery ticket and note the affected experiment IDs. Once approved, launch the recovery console and select "restore operator." The console will prompt for the vault passphrase; the current recovery passphrase is printed below.

unlock words, yawig-kagef: gordor-holvan-ulaael-pramir-ulaiel-tamdor

### Runbook: BounceBroom — Account Recovery

If the BounceBroom email bounce processor loses access to its service account, do not create a new one. First, pause the intake queue so bounces buffer safely. Then open the recovery console and select the BounceBroom principal. Verification requires approval from the on-call lead. Once approved, the console prompts for the stored recovery credentials; enter the passphrase that appears directly below this paragraph.

recovery phrase for fahof-kahap: holion-gormir-jorix-istix-briwyn-sorael

Subject: Pricefork cut-over complete

Hello plugin authors,

The Pricefork ticket-pricing experiment has been cut over to the new allocation engine as of this morning. Legacy hooks still fire, but deprecation begins next cycle. Please verify your surcharge plugins against the staging tier before Friday. The production configuration now in effect is listed below:

deployment values, yadug-bawif:
[framir]
team = pelox
access_code = ac_a38ab2
owner = tamion.julael
host = framir.tolvaqlabs.test
port = 11211
peer = tammir.zemvargrid.local
salt = 2215ef03
pin = 1541